AVX EXPANDS ITS AWARD-WINNING 9296 SINGLE POKE-HOME WTB CONTACT SERIES WITH NEW 1.7MM CONTACT

Low-profile 9296 Series contacts provide full connector performance without the added expense of an insulator, enabling simple, reliable, cost-effective, & solderless termination in a broad range of harsh industrial applications


GREENVILLE, SC, S.C., Jan. 29, 2014 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- GREENVILLE, S.C. (January 29, 2014) – AVX Corporation, a leading manufacturer of passive components and interconnect solutions, has further expanded its award-winning 9296 Single Poke-Home Wire-to-Board (WTB) Contact Series with the addition of an extremely low profile (1.7mm) single-position contact.  Recently recognized with an Electronic Products Product of the Year Award for design innovation, price, and performance, the 9296 Series contacts enable the simple, reliable, and solderless termination of power, signal, and ground wires in a broad range of harsh industrial applications and exhibit full connector performance without the added expense of an insulator and its associated assembly costs.  Featuring a unique closed box design with dual opposing high spring-force contacts that provide excellent wire retention in rugged environments, 9296 Series contacts are now available with 1.7mm, 2mm, 3mm, and 4mm profiles.

Integrating several key features within the stamping to facilitate SMT pickup, wire guidance, high force retention, and easy twist-and-pull wire removal, 9296 Series WTB contacts have upper and lower tines that guide stripped wires down the center of the contact zone and an integral end-stop to ensure proper insertion depth and maximum mechanical stability.

The 1.7mm 9296 Series contact is rated for 5A-8A and is capable of accepting solid or stranded 22, 24, and 26AWG wires.  The 2mm, 3mm, and 4mm 9296 Series contacts are rated for up to 20A and can accommodate solid or stranded wires ranging from 12-28AWG.  All 9296 Series contacts are RoHS compliant and are rated for five-cycle durability and temperatures spanning -40°C to +125°C.  Voltage ratings for the series are dependent upon placement distance between individual contacts, which are tape and reel packaged for automated single contact placement and SMT reflow.

Additional applications for the series include: smart grid meters, breakers, and panels; SSL/LED bulbs, fixtures, signage, and streetlights; machine controls, including motors, drives, solenoids, sensors, fans, and pumps; and commercial building controls, such as fire and security sensors.

About AVX
AVX Corporation is a leading international supplier of electronic passive components and interconnect solutions with 26 manufacturing and customer support facilities in 15 countries around the world. AVX offers a broad range of devices including capacitors, resistors, filters, timing and circuit protection devices and connectors. The company is publicly traded on the New York Stock Exchange (NYSE:AVX).
